版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
学校________________班级____________姓名____________考场____________准考证号学校________________班级____________姓名____________考场____________准考证号…………密…………封…………线…………内…………不…………要…………答…………题…………第1页,共3页洛阳职业技术学院
《分布式数据库系统》2023-2024学年第二学期期末试卷题号一二三四总分得分批阅人一、单选题(本大题共20个小题,每小题1分,共20分.在每小题给出的四个选项中,只有一项是符合题目要求的.)1、在分布式数据库中,数据查询是一个常见的操作。以下关于数据查询的策略中,错误的是?()A.数据查询可以使用SQL语言或特定的分布式查询语言,根据数据的分布情况和查询需求进行选择B.数据查询可以通过将查询分解成多个子查询并在不同节点上并行执行来提高效率C.数据查询可以采用缓存和预取技术,减少数据的读取时间D.数据查询只需要考虑查询性能,不需要考虑数据的一致性和完整性2、分布式数据库系统中的查询优化是一个复杂的任务。假设一个查询需要从多个数据节点获取数据并进行复杂的关联和聚合操作,以下哪种优化技术能够最有效地减少数据传输量和提高查询性能?()A.在发送查询到其他数据节点之前,先在本地进行数据过滤和预处理B.采用基于成本的查询优化器,根据数据分布和网络状况评估不同执行计划的开销C.将关联和聚合操作尽量在数据量较小的数据节点上进行D.以上技术的综合应用能够最有效地减少数据传输量和提高查询性能3、一个分布式数据库系统采用了主从复制的架构,其中主节点负责处理写入操作,从节点用于读取操作。在网络出现故障导致主节点与部分从节点失去连接的情况下,以下关于系统可用性和数据一致性的处理策略,哪一项是最合适的?()A.暂停所有写入和读取操作,直到网络恢复,以确保数据的一致性,但会导致系统在网络故障期间不可用B.允许在从节点上进行读取操作,但暂时禁止写入操作,等待网络恢复后将从节点的数据与主节点进行同步,这样可以在一定程度上保持系统的可用性C.继续在主节点上进行写入操作,并在网络恢复后将更新同步到从节点。从节点在网络故障期间可以提供基于本地数据的读取服务,但可能会提供不一致的数据D.切换一个从节点作为新的主节点,继续提供写入和读取服务,网络恢复后再解决数据冲突和一致性问题,这种方式可以保持系统的高可用性,但数据冲突解决可能比较复杂4、分布式数据库的架构有多种类型。对于去中心化架构的描述,不准确的是()A.不存在中心控制节点B.节点之间地位平等C.系统的可扩展性好D.数据一致性容易保证5、在选择分布式数据库的架构时,以下哪个因素对于系统的可扩展性影响最大?()A.数据存储方式B.节点之间的通信机制C.事务处理方式D.以上都是6、在一个分布式数据库系统中,为了提高系统的可扩展性,以下哪种设计原则是重要的?()A.松耦合架构B.模块化设计C.无状态服务D.以上都是7、在分布式数据库的性能优化中,以下哪种方法对于减少数据传输量和提高网络效率最为有效?()A.数据压缩和编码B.增加网络带宽C.减少数据冗余D.以上都是8、在一个分布式数据库系统中,节点之间的通信协议对于系统的性能和可靠性有着重要作用。假设一个分布式科研数据共享平台,节点之间需要频繁传输大量的实验数据和元数据。以下哪种通信协议能够提供高效、可靠的数据传输,同时支持复杂的消息交互?()A.TCP/IP协议B.HTTP协议C.AMQP协议D.WebSocket协议9、在一个分布式数据库系统中,数据的分布和复制策略需要根据业务需求进行调整。假设系统用于存储一个社交媒体平台的用户动态和评论数据,以下哪种策略可能最适合提高数据的访问性能和可用性?()A.按照用户ID进行数据分片,并在多个节点上复制热门用户的数据B.按照时间顺序对数据进行分片,并在相邻的节点上进行数据复制C.随机分布数据,并在每个节点上保留完整的数据副本D.根据数据的类型(动态或评论)进行分片,在特定的节点上进行复制10、分布式数据库系统中的资源管理包括计算资源、存储资源和网络资源等。假设一个分布式视频流媒体服务的数据库,处理大量的视频播放请求和用户数据。以下关于资源管理的描述,哪一项是不正确的?()A.可以根据节点的负载情况动态分配计算资源,以提高系统的整体处理能力B.存储资源的管理需要考虑数据的增长和存储成本,合理选择存储介质和架构C.网络资源的管理包括带宽分配、流量控制和数据压缩,以减少数据传输延迟D.资源管理只需要关注当前的需求,不需要预测未来的资源增长和变化11、在分布式数据库中,数据的复制策略会影响数据的一致性和可用性。以下哪种复制策略在节点故障时恢复速度较快?()A.主从复制B.多主复制C.无主复制D.以上都不是12、在分布式数据库系统中,事务的原子性、一致性、隔离性和持久性(ACID)特性面临着新的挑战。假设一个分布式银行系统,处理多个账户之间的转账操作。对于以下关于分布式事务特性保障的描述,哪一项是错误的?()A.原子性要求转账操作要么全部完成,要么全部不完成,不能出现部分成功部分失败的情况B.一致性确保转账前后账户的余额总和不变,以及满足银行的业务规则C.隔离性使得一个事务在执行过程中不受其他并发事务的干扰D.持久性只需要保证事务在本地节点成功提交后的数据不丢失,无需考虑其他节点13、在一个分布式数据库系统中,如果需要实现数据的分区容错性,以下哪种技术是关键的?()A.副本技术B.数据一致性协议C.分布式事务处理D.以上都是14、在分布式数据库系统中,数据分区是一种常见的优化策略。假设有一个分布式视频分享平台的数据库,存储了大量的视频信息和用户数据。以下关于数据分区的说法,不正确的是:()A.可以按照视频的类型(如电影、电视剧、综艺节目)进行分区,将相同类型的视频数据存储在一个分区中,方便管理和查询B.数据分区可以提高数据的局部性,减少跨分区的查询和数据传输,从而提高系统性能C.当需要对分区进行调整(如增加或合并分区)时,可能会涉及到大量的数据迁移和重新组织,带来较大的系统开销D.数据分区可以随意进行,不需要考虑数据的特点和访问模式,因为分区操作对系统性能的影响很小15、考虑一个分布式数据库系统,其中部分节点的存储空间即将耗尽。为了避免数据丢失和系统性能下降,以下哪种策略是首先应该考虑实施的?()A.立即购买新的存储设备来扩展节点的存储空间B.将部分数据迁移到其他有足够存储空间的节点C.对数据进行归档和清理,删除不再需要的历史数据D.对数据进行压缩,以节省存储空间16、分布式数据库系统中的数据复制可以提高系统的可用性和性能。假设一个分布式电商库存管理系统,库存数据需要在多个节点上进行复制。如果复制过程中出现网络分区,以下哪种处理方式能够在保证数据一致性的前提下,最大程度地提高系统的可用性?()A.停止所有数据更新操作,直到网络分区恢复B.在不同的分区内独立进行数据更新,网络恢复后进行数据合并和冲突解决C.只允许在主节点进行数据更新,其他节点暂停服务D.随机选择一个分区进行数据更新,其他分区等待17、当分布式数据库中的节点数量增加时,以下哪种通信协议对于提高节点之间的通信效率更为重要?()A.TCPB.UDPC.HTTPD.RPC18、在分布式数据库系统中,以下哪种数据分布方式更适合具有复杂关联关系的数据?()A.哈希分布B.范围分布C.随机分布D.复制分布19、分布式数据库系统中的数据迁移是常见的操作。假设有一个不断发展的分布式电商数据库,由于业务增长需要将部分数据从一个节点迁移到另一个节点。以下关于数据迁移的描述,不正确的是:()A.数据迁移前需要制定详细的计划,包括迁移的时间、数据量、目标节点等B.在数据迁移过程中,需要确保数据的一致性和完整性,避免数据丢失或损坏C.数据迁移完成后,需要对迁移的数据进行验证和测试,确保其能够正常访问和使用D.数据迁移可以在系统运行时进行,不会对正在进行的业务操作产生任何影响,无需暂停服务20、某分布式数据库系统中的一个节点负载过高,为了缓解该节点的压力,以下哪种方法是比较有效的?()A.数据分片和重新分布B.增加该节点的硬件资源C.优化该节点上的查询和事务处理D.以上都是二、简答题(本大题共5个小题,共25分)1、(本题5分)在分布式系统中,如何进行数据库的缓存一致性协议选择和优化,确保缓存数据的一致性和有效性。2、(本题5分)在分布式系统中,如何进行数据库的参数调优,包括内存参数、连接参数和并发控制参数等,以适应不同的工作负载。3、(本题5分)论述分布式数据库系统中的容错机制,包括故障检测、恢复策略以及数据备份和恢复技术,举例说明在实际系统中的应用。4、(本题5分)请说明在分布式环境下如何进行数据库的索引合并和索引重建,优化索引结构提高查询性能。5、(本题5分)论述在分布式环境中如何进行数据库的连接优化,包括连接顺序选择、连接条件优化和连接算法改进,提高连接操作的性能。三、综合应用题(本大题共5个小题,共25分)1、(本题5分)一个在线旅游平台计划开展旅游达人分享业务,需要处理达人的旅行经历、攻略和用户互动数据。请设计分布式数据库系统来支持旅游达人分享,包括数据的采集和存储、达人分享内容的管理和推荐、用户互动数据的分析和处理,以及如何保障分享内容的质量和用户体验。2、(本题5分)某移动支付平台每天处理大量的交易数据,为了应对高并发和数据安全的挑战,采用分布式数据库架构。请设计该平台的数据库架构,包括数据存储、备份和恢复策略,以及如何防止欺诈交易和数据泄露。3、(本题5分)一个大型社交网络平台需要存储海量的用户关系和动态信息,设计分布式数据库系统来支持高效的数据查询和好友推荐功能。分析如何处理数据的快速增长和复杂的关系查询。4、(本题5分)某在线医疗平台存储大量患者的病历和诊断数据,出于数据隐私和可用性的考虑,采用分布式数据库架构。设计数据库的安全机制和数据备份策略,同时考虑如何优化医疗数据的查询和分析性能。5、(本题5分)一家物流企业为预测货物需求,对历史订单数据进行时间序列分析。说明在分布式数据库中如何进行时间序列数据的存储和分析。四、论述题(本大题共3个小题,共30分)1、(本题10分)在大规模分布式数据库系统中,如何有效地管理和优化存储资源是一个重要问题。论述存储资源管理的策略和方法,如存储空间分配、存储介质选择等,分析如何根据数据的访问模式和存储需求进行优化,并探讨如何应对存储
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 城投融资考试题库及答案
- 公文写作大赛试题及答案
- 2025-2026人教版五年级语文期末真题卷
- 2025-2026人教版一年级语文测试卷上学期
- 2025-2026五年级体育期末测试卷2025
- 装修公司施工管理制度
- 秦安县医疗卫生制度
- 酒店卫生局管理制度
- 蔬菜类卫生安全管理制度
- 物业公司爱卫生管理制度
- 2025年司法鉴定人资格考试历年真题试题及答案
- 江苏省连云港市2024-2025学年第一学期期末调研考试高二历史试题
- 生成式人工智能与初中历史校本教研模式的融合与创新教学研究课题报告
- 2025年湖北烟草专卖局笔试试题及答案
- 2026年开工第一课复工复产安全专题培训
- 特殊人群(老人、儿童)安全护理要点
- 2026年检察院书记员面试题及答案
- 《煤矿安全规程(2025)》防治水部分解读课件
- 2025至2030中国新癸酸缩水甘油酯行业项目调研及市场前景预测评估报告
- 2025年保安员职业技能考试笔试试题(100题)含答案
- 尾矿库闭库综合治理工程项目可行性研究报告
评论
0/150
提交评论